Description:
Obverse
Heads of the five kings of Belgium facing left in separate medallions. Years of jubilee to the left divided by legend in French. Small crown above lower year.
Reverse
Map of Belgiuminscripted with text in French. Value below divided by mint and privy mark. Designer initials to the right.
